rmzalbar Posted March 11, 2021 Share Posted March 11, 2021 (edited) On 3/9/2021 at 1:42 PM, kbj said: I guess as long as the case is complete I could try a bit of retro brighting? Also, is the keyboard repairable? Retrobriting worked great on my 1200XL, and the original keyboard membrane can usually be repaired if it's failed in the typical way, at the point where it interfaces with the connector. Even if it can't, there is a new-manufacture replacement membrane available from Best Electronics that worked perfectly for me (though I saved my original membrane too as it turned out to be repairable.) When retrobriting, disassemble the shell completely, separating the brown and smoked panels from the shell so you can treat the white plastic only.
